Understanding Treadmills: Types, Benefits, and Considerations
Treadmills have actually ended up being an integral part of physical fitness culture, providing a practical service for individuals looking for to improve their cardiovascular fitness without the need for outside areas or weather considerations. With a selection of functions and designs available, potential buyers must be well-informed to make the best choice. This post intends to supply a comprehensive overview of treadmills, including the various types, benefits, and elements to think about when purchasing one.
The Different Types of Treadmills1. Handbook Treadmills
Manual treadmills are powered by the user rather than an electric motor. They need no electrical energy and usually feature a basic design with fewer moving parts.
Benefits of Manual Treadmills:Cost-effectivePortable and light-weightNo dependence on electrical powerDrawbacks:Limited featuresNormally do not have slope choices2. Motorized Treadmills
Motorized treadmills are the most typical type, powered by an electric motor. They generally use various features such as programmable exercise routines, adjustable inclines, and greater weight capabilities.
Benefits of Motorized Treadmills:Smooth operation and constant tractionVersatile with advanced functions for varied exercisesOptions for incline and decrease settingsDrawbacks:Higher expense compared to manual treadmillsRequire electricity and might increase electric expenses3. Folding Treadmills
Folding treadmills are developed for easy storage, making them perfect for those with minimal space.
Advantages of Folding Treadmills:Space-saving styleEasy to transfer and storeAppropriate for home use where area is at a premiumDownsides:Typically may have a smaller running surfaceWeight limitation may be lower than non-folding models4. Commercial Treadmills
These treadmills are built for durability and performance, generally discovered in gyms and physical fitness centers. They are developed for high use rates and come with sophisticated functions.

Treadmills use many benefits for individuals aiming to enhance their fitness levels or keep an athletic routine.
1. Convenience
Owning a treadmill permits users to work out at their own schedule, getting rid of dependence on weather. It supplies versatility, as exercises can happen day or night.
2. Customizable Workouts
Many modern treadmills include customizable programs to accommodate newbies and seasoned professional athletes. Users can adjust speed, incline, and workout period to take full advantage of the efficiency of their sessions.
3. Tracking Progress
A lot of treadmills come geared up with digital screens that tape-record important statistics such as range, speed, calories burned, and heart rate. Monitoring this information assists users track their fitness development over time.
4. Lowered Impact
Treadmills often supply a cushioned surface area that can decrease joint effect compared to working on difficult outdoor surfaces, making them an appropriate alternative for people with joint concerns or those recuperating from injuries.
5. Variety of Workouts
Users can participate in different workouts on a treadmill, from walking and jogging to interval training and speed work. Some machines even use integrated courses that replicate outside surfaces.
Considerations When Buying a Treadmill
When purchasing a treadmill, people need to consider a number of factors to guarantee they make a notified choice.

What is the average life-span of a treadmill?
Usually, a premium treadmill can last in between 7 to 12 years, depending on usage, upkeep, and construct quality.
2. What is the best treadmill brand?
Popular brands include NordicTrack, Sole Fitness, Precor, and LifeSpan, each understood for their quality and consumer satisfaction.
3. Can I use a treadmill for walking?
Yes, treadmills are perfect for walking, jogging, or running, making them versatile for users of all fitness levels.
4. How frequently should I service my treadmill?
Regular upkeep is typically advised every six months to guarantee ideal performance and durability.
5. Is it all right to work on a treadmill every day?
While running on a treadmill daily is appropriate for some, it's wise to integrate day of rest or alternate exercises to avoid possible overuse injuries.
